- " first implementation done on 2008 Sep 14 08:31:10 PM
- " After including this code in TOVL (which is deprecated) this code has a new
- " (final)
- " home in vim-addon-sql now.
- "
- " alternative plugins: SQLComplete and dbext (However the completion system
- " provided by this code is more accurate cause it only shows fields of all
- " talbes found in a query. What is a query? See ThisSQLCommand
- "
- " supported databases:
- " - MySQL
- " - postgresql
- " - sqlite (work in progress
- "
- " There are two windows:
- " a) the result window
- " b) the error window
- "
- " Mayb this code could be cleaned up ?

- " =========== selecting dbs ==========================================
- " of course it's not a real "connection". It's an object which knows how to
- " run the cmd line tools
- function! vim_addon_sql#Connect(dbType,settings)
- let types = {
- \ 'mysql' : function('vim_addon_sql#MysqlConn'),
- \ 'pg' : function('vim_addon_sql#PostgresConn'),
- \ 'sqlite' : function('vim_addon_sql#SqliteConn'),
- \ 'firebird' : function('vim_addon_sql#FirebirdConn')
- \ }
- let b:db_conn = types[a:dbType](a:settings)
- endfunction
- " the following functions (only MySQL, Postgresql, SQLite implemented yet) all return
- " an "object" having the function
- " query(sql) runs any query and returns the result from stderr and stdout
- " tables() list of tables
- " fields(table) list of fields of the given table
- " invalidateSchema() removes cached schema data
- " schema returns the schema
- " regex.table : regex matching a table identifier
